Version Rust License Platform Stay Amazing

An AI-native terminal spreadsheet. Open a CSV or workbook, navigate and edit like a spreadsheet, write formulas, or just tell Claude what to change. A small, fast, single binary — part of the Fe2O3 Rust terminal suite.


The idea

A spreadsheet that stays out of your way and lets the AI do the tedious parts. Type values and formulas directly, or hit I and say "add a Total row that sums each column" — grid hands the sheet to Claude and applies what comes back. No menus, no ribbons: keyboard-driven, instant, scriptable.

Features

  • Formats — reads/writes CSV, reads xlsx/ods (via calamine) and writes xlsx (via rust_xlsxwriter), preserving formulas and their computed values.
  • Formula engine — hand-rolled, no spreadsheet runtime: arithmetic, ranges (A1:B3), comparisons, & concatenation, and ~25 functions (SUM, AVERAGE, MIN/MAX, COUNT, IF, AND/OR, ROUND, CONCAT, VLOOKUP, …). Whole-sheet recalc with cycle detection (#CYCLE).
  • AI editingI → describe a change in plain English; Claude rewrites the sheet, formulas included.
  • Range selectionv starts a rectangular selection; colouring, clearing colour (D) and clearing content all apply to the whole block.
  • Cell colours — true-colour (24-bit) foreground/background (C) via the prism picker (or a #rrggbb/name prompt); persists to xlsx natively and to CSV via a .gcolors sidecar.
  • Undo — every edit, clear, colour and AI change is undoable (u).
  • Multi-sheetTab cycles sheets in a workbook.
  • Dates — Excel date serials shown as readable YYYY-MM-DD.
  • Tiny binary, blocking input — zero idle CPU.

Install

# From a release (Linux/macOS, x86_64/aarch64)
chmod +x grid-* && sudo cp grid-linux-x86_64 /usr/local/bin/grid

# Or build from source (needs the sibling crust crate alongside)
git clone https://github.com/isene/crust
git clone https://github.com/isene/grid
cd grid && cargo build --release

Usage

grid budget.csv      # open a file
grid sheet.xlsx      # open a workbook (Tab cycles sheets)
grid new.csv         # start a fresh sheet

Keys

Key Action
h j k l / arrows move
g G first / last row
0 $ first / last column
PgUp PgDn page
Enter i edit cell
= start a formula
I AI edit (Claude)
v start / stop rectangular selection
C set cell / selection colour (prism)
D clear cell / selection colour
u undo
d Del clear cell / selection content
Tab S-Tab next / previous sheet
s save
? help
q / Q quit / quit without saving

Formulas

=A1+B2*2, ranges =SUM(A1:A10), text =A1&" "&B1, logic =IF(C1>0,"ok","no"), and: SUM AVERAGE MIN MAX COUNT COUNTA PRODUCT IF AND OR NOT ROUND ABS INT SQRT MOD POWER CONCAT LEN LEFT RIGHT MID UPPER LOWER TRIM VLOOKUP.

Part of Fe2O3

grid is one tool in the Fe2O3 suite of fast Rust terminal apps. It builds on crust (the TUI foundation) and pairs with viewer, which launches grid for spreadsheet files.
